π Stella's Elixir Lounge — Happy Hour + Final Fridays
WEEKLY + MONTHLYHuntsville's premier rooftop cocktail lounge — awarded Best Cocktail Bar every year since opening in 2020 — and consistently named the top ladies' night destination on Yelp. The 4,000 sq ft rooftop blends indoor swank with outdoor cabanas and fire pits, and reviewers call it the go-to for a girls' night that feels classy without being pretentious. Happy Hour runs 3–7 PM daily with $3 beers/seltzers and $5 wine. Every Thursday is $7 mules all day. And Final Fridays (last Friday of every month) transform the rooftop into a themed event — Pirate Night, Disco, Tropical Escape — with live music at 5 PM and a DJ spinning until 2 AM.

π¨ Huntsville Museum of Art — $5 After 5 Thursdays
EVERY THUEvery Thursday from 5–8 PM, admission drops to just $5 — and wine is available inside. Each week features live music or a guest performer alongside docent-led tours of current exhibitions. February 2026 events included an opera singer, a blues guitarist, and a guitar duo — all paired with wine and the galleries to wander. It's the most underrated ladies' night in the city and one of the most affordable. Members get in free.
π· Domaine South
$$–$$$Huntsville's most celebrated wine bar — and for good reason. European-inspired, bohemian in feel, with natural wines, rotating seasonal menus, housemade charcuterie, and a patio overlooking Big Spring Park that's genuinely one of the prettiest spots in the city. The Northside Square location is a proper wine shop and bar. Thursday wine tastings are a recurring feature. This is the place when the night calls for wine, cheese, and real conversation.
π Mazzara's Vinoteca
$$–$$$An authentic Italian wine bar and restaurant inside one of downtown Huntsville's most beautiful historic homes — dating to 1848. Handmade pasta, eggplant rollatini, limoncello cake, and an extensive wine list including curated wine flights. The intimate rooms and dim lighting make it ideal for a dinner that turns into a long evening over wine. They host pop-up wine tastings through the Church Street Wine Club — worth checking the calendar. Private parties available Sundays. Wine and beer only, no spirits.

π΄ Rocket City Rover — Pedal Trolley GNO
$$Not a bar — but one of Huntsville's most beloved girls' night experiences. The pedal trolley fits up to 14 passengers and tours through downtown or the local microbrewery circuit. Mon–Thu $25/person, Fri–Sun $30/person. You pedal, you laugh, you stop at breweries. It's the perfect mobile bachelorette or birthday GNO that gets the whole group moving and drinking at the same time.

Women's Expo Huntsville (Annual · March) — Three-day women's empowerment conference and expo at The Westin, Bridge Street. Gala, speakers, marketplace, Pink Bosses Dinner, Sunday Brunch. One of North Alabama's biggest women-focused events of the year. Check thewomensexpohsv.com for 2027 dates.
RosΓ© Ball (Annual · Spring · Stovehouse) — Black-tie optional charity event benefiting North Alabama women's nonprofits. Complimentary rosΓ©, Bubbles Lounge, dancing, hors d'oeuvres, cash bar. The GNO formal event of the year.
Kentucky Derby Watch Party · Stella's (Annual · May) — 5th Annual Derby Party on the rooftop. Best hat contest, Derby cocktails, live music, door prizes, seersucker and fascinators required. Sell-out event every year.
HMA Annual Gala (February · Ticketed) — The Huntsville Museum of Art's most glamorous fundraiser night. 35th Annual Gala in 2026. Dress up and support local art.
